The surname Xianyu has two origins:

1. It comes from the surname Zi, which is the combination of the name of the country and the name of the town. At the end of the Shang Dynasty, King Zhou had his uncle Jizi, who was granted the title of Imperial Master in Ji (now Taigu County, Shanxi Province). He repeatedly remonstrated with King Zhou about his debauchery and cruelty, but King Zhou remained the same and did not want to repent. Zi was imprisoned. After King Wu of Zhou destroyed the Shang Dynasty, Jizi bluntly advised King Wu to practice benevolent government, but he refused to accept King Wu's request and serve as a minister again. He left Liaodong and established the country of Korea (it is said that this country was the predecessor of today's North Korea). According to legend, one of his descendants, Zhongzhong, was granted the title of Yuyi. He combined the name of the country and the name of the city and called himself the Xianyu clan.

2 King Zhou of Shang Dynasty had an uncle who was sealed in Ji (in the east of Taigu County, Shanxi) and was called Jizi. Not long after King Zhou came to the throne, when Jizi saw that he started to use ivory chopsticks, he sighed: "If you use ivory chopsticks, you must use jade cups to match them, and then you will pursue other rare items. This is the beginning of luxury and enjoyment!" How can the country run well if the king only cares about pleasure?" As expected, King Zhou became more and more debauched and cruel. Jizi remonstrated many times, and King Zhou became impatient and simply locked him up. After King Zhou Wu destroyed the Shang Dynasty, he released Jizi and asked him for advice on how to gain the support of the merchants. Jizi believed that benevolent government should be implemented and pacification methods should be used to win the hearts of the people. King Wu wanted to make Jizi an official, but Jizi did not want to be a minister of Zhou, so he fled to Liaodong and established the state of Korea. Among the descendants of Jizi, there was a man named Zhong who had a fiefdom in Yu. He combined the character "Xian" in the name of the country and the character "Yu" in the name of the town into the word "Xianyu" as his surname, and called it the Xianyu family.

County Hope:

[Edit this paragraph]

Taiyuan County: During the Warring States Period, the Qin State established a county, and its administrative seat was Jinyang (today’s Taiyuan City, Shanxi Province) .

Yuyang County: During the Warring States Period, the State of Yan established a county, and the Qin and Han Dynasties followed it. The place of governance was Yuyang (now southwest of Miyun County, Beijing City).

Migration:

[Edit this paragraph]

The Xianyu surname was active in the north in the early days. After the Han Dynasty, it formed a prominent family in Beijing, with Yuyang County as the county leader. . After the Song Dynasty, in addition to Hebei, Inner Mongolia, and Northeast China, there was a certain distribution in Sichuan and other places as well as among the Koreans. At present, the population of Xianyu is not among the top 300 in the country.
